proftpd mit TLS ohne SHELL

Das Kamel

Das Kamel

Mitglied
Ahoi,

ich probiere mich zur Zeit mal wieder ein bisschen mit Debian, dabei habe ich einen FTP Server mit proftpd und TLS aufgesetzt.
Soweit alles gut. Anschließend möchte ich einen User mit
Code:
adduser --gecos GECOS --ingroup ftpgroup --shell /bin/false --home /ftp/user/ user
anlegen.
Das funktioniert auch noch wie ich es mir vorstelle.

Wenn ich jetzt aber zum Beispiel mit FileZilla auf den Server connecten will bekomm ich gesagt
Code:
Antwort:	530 Login incorrect.
Fehler:	Herstellen der Verbindung zum Server fehlgeschlagen

wenn ich das
Code:
--shell /bin/false
weglasse, dann funktioniert es problemlos.

Ich möchte nun aber nicht unbedingt, das jeder User vollen Zugang zu dem Server hat. Vielleicht weis ja jemand von euch wo mein Fehler liegt. Danke schon mal für eure Hilfe.
 
Code:
RequireValidShell off
In die /etc/proftpd/proftpd.conf, dann sollte es gehen ;)
 
ok, danke

der eintrag war vorhanden, nur leider als kommentar.

jetzt geht alles, danke
 
Wenn du von der Shell entkoppelte User hast, sind virtuelle User manchmal auch keine schlechte Idee. (Obige Lösung ist natürlich für kleine Installationen die geeignete Wahl)
 

Ähnliche Themen

Samba 3.6.25 - OpenLDAP Setup

Zugriff Ubuntu 16.04. auf Freigabe 18.04. LTS nicht möglich

Zugriff auf Samba Fileserver Freigaben verweigert(Samba 4 Active Directory Domäne)

Proftpd/TLS Probleme

Samba 4 Gast Zugang unter Ubuntu funktioniert nicht

Zurück
Oben